Anna Ballbona

Writer and journalist

Anna Ballbona is a writer and journalist. She has published the novels No soc aquí (Llibres Anagrama Prize 2020) and Joyce i les gallines (Anagrama, 2016), translated into Spanish, German and Greek. She is the author of the books of poems La mare que et renyava era un robot (Galerada, 2017) and Conill de gàbia (La Breu Edicions, 2012), and of the non-fiction Elles competeixen (Ciutat de Barcelona Award Grant 2021). She has a master's degree in Comparative Literature from the UAB, writes in the "Quadern" of El País and collaborates in the literature program of Catalunya Ràdio Ciutat Maragda. She has received a Leonardo grant from the BBVA Foundation for her next literary project. She has created the interview podcast Domini màgic, and has prefaced the new edition of Jordi Cussà's novel Formentera Lady (Comanegra, 2023).
